## Runbook: Lanternfell catalogue import

Runs nightly at 01:00. If the import stalls, check the feed from the Quillmarsh branch first — it's the usual culprit. Kill stuck workers, clear the staging table, rerun with the resume flag. Do not rerun without clearing; duplicates will poison search. Escalate only after two failed retries. The importer starts with these values.

settings of yageg-yahap:
[gorael]
team = olieth
access_code = ac_941d74
owner = brieth.aldiel
host = gorael.tolvaqio.internal
port = 6379
peer = briwyn.urlaqtech.internal
salt = 116e6622
pin = 1957

Action item from the Pemberton incident review: the shrinkray CLI silently dropped EXIF data during batch resizes, corrupting the Fernvale asset pipeline. Fix shipped in 2.3, but operators must pin that version and run with --verify-checksums until the wrapper script lands. Owner: platform tooling rotation. Due: next sprint. Do not re-enable the nightly resize cron before verification passes. Validation steps, flag reference, and known-bad version list are documented on the internal page below.

wiki page, bagaf-fawip: https://harbor.tolvaqsys.local/pages/repo/pages/secrets/eac969ffc71f356b

# Artifact Signing — Slimmage Pipeline

All slimmed container images produced by the Slimmage pipeline must be signed before promotion to the Dunmore registry. The slimming step strips layers, so digests differ from the upstream base image — never reuse upstream signatures. Signing happens after the size-check gate and before the promotion job; unsigned images are garbage-collected nightly. Verification is enforced at deploy time by the admission hook. The current pipeline signing key, rotated quarterly, is listed below for reference.

release key, hagug-yaguf: bky13_NnhXrmFGhCRtW

- [ ] Flaky integration tests — Tollgate payments service. Support folks: if a merchant escalation mentions failed settlement retries, first check whether the nightly integration suite went red. About a third of those failures are flaky, not real, usually the ledger-sync tests timing out. Don't reopen tickets just because the suite failed once; wait for the rerun. If it fails twice in a row, escalate. For triage and quarantine decisions, the accountable person is named below.

named custodian: Oliath Ralax